auto-redirect to http://wpkg.org

Hi everybody,

today when I try to visit some website from China, safari auto-redirect me to this website: "http://wpkg.org".

Do you think it's a virus or a malware?

There is the same situation also surfing with firefox.

Please, help me because it's impossibile to explore any website.

1. Use free AdwareMedic to remove adware


http://www.adwaremedic.com/index.php


Install , open, and run it by clicking “Scan for Adware” button to remove adware.

Once done, quit AdwareMedic.


or


Remove the adware manually by following the “HowTo” from Apple.

http://support.apple.com/en-us/HT203987



2. Safari > Preferences > Extensions

Turn those off and relaunch Safari.

Turn those on one by one and test.


3. Safari > Preferences > Search > Search Engine :

Select your preferred search engine.
